**The Role**:
Icon Homes is currently seeking a Civil Engineering Technician to join our growing team. This is an exciting opportunity for a detail-oriented and motivated professional to play a key role in the delivery of high-end residential construction projects across Sydney.

As a Civil Engineering Technician, you will work closely with project managers, engineers, designers, and site supervisors to ensure the technical quality and compliance of our construction works. You’ll support the full project lifecycle—from technical assessments to on-site inspections—ensuring every detail meets the highest standards

**Principal Responsibilities**
- Review job sites and inspect construction quality to ensure adherence to design specifications and standards.
- Analyze engineering, architectural, hydraulic, and stormwater drainage plans.
- Review and interpret Geotechnical reports and provide insights for construction planning.
- Prepare bar bending schedules and coordinate steel and reinforcement bar orders.
- Verify structural steel and framing details, including compliance with engineering requirements.
- Conduct regular site visits for inspections, quality assurance, and compliance checks.
- Support the sales and tendering teams by providing technical expertise in presentations, client meetings, and project proposals.
- Perform fieldwork, including site surveys and inspections of civil engineering works and construction materials.
- Communicate effectively with contractors, consultants, and internal teams to resolve technical issues.
- Ensure projects comply with industry regulations, safety standards, and company policies
